Cardamom (Currently Out of Stock, Awaiting more)
PRODUCT DESCRIPTION
A close relative to Ginger, Cardamom is known as an
expensive cooking spice and for being beneficial to the
digestive system in a variety of ways. Cardamom is
commonly used internally to help soothe occasional
stomach discomfort.* Its distinct scent can promote a
positive mood. Ingested Cardamom also has profound
effects on the respiratory system due to its high 1,8-cineole
content, which promotes clear breathing and respiratory
health.* Native to Southeast Asia, Cardamom is added to
traditional Indian sweets and teas for its cool, minty aroma
and flavor. dōTERRA Cardamom essential oil is extracted
from Cardamom seeds grown in Guatemala, using our strict
CPTG® testing standards. Through a collaborative and
responsible sourcing arrangement, we are able to have a
significant impact on the lives of local partners, ensuring
that these farming communities enjoy improved livelihoods.

DIRECTIONS FOR USE
Diffusion: Use three to four drops in the diffuser of choice.
Internal use: Dilute one drop in 4 fl. oz. of liquid.
Topical use: Apply one to two drops to desired area. Dilute
with a carrier oil to minimize any skin sensitivity. See
additional precautions below.
CAUTIONS
Possible skin sensitivity. Keep out of reach of children. If
you are pregnant, nursing, or under a doctor’s care, consult
your physician. Avoid contact with eyes, inner ears, and
sensitive areas.
